Howth Findlater is one of those rare village venues that manages to feel steeped in history while remaining fresh, stylish and wonderfully relevant. Named after Alexander Findlater, the noted whiskey trader and philanthropist, this landmark building continues to honour that legacy under the stewardship of Michael Wright, whose own contribution to Howth is plain to see. I was especially taken by the two distinct food offerings available here. Firstly, the bar menu delivers comforting favourites with real flair, making it ideal for a relaxed lunch or casual bite by the sea. Secondly, the restaurant offering brings a more polished dining experience, where carefully prepared dishes and quality ingredients take centre stage. Add to that a superb drinks selection, from a perfectly poured Guinness to expertly made cocktails, and you have a venue that truly caters for all tastes. Findlater remains one of Howth’s most impressive places to dine, unwind and soak up local character.
